You are within easy reach of the thriving city of Durham, which boasts a number of tourist attractions that are a must-see during your trip. For a taste of history, venture towards Durham Cathedral, an iconic Romanesque building, and is set on a rocky promontory with sweeping river and country views surrounding. The historic Durham Castle is also popular, dating back to the 11th century and boasting a fine collection of art inside and offering a look into historical architecture. Durham University Botanic Gardens span across 10 hectares and house plants and shrubbery from around the world, with a lovely visitor centre and plenty of opportunities for some scenic walking. SHADFORTH
Durham 5 miles; Sunderland 9 miles.
Shadforth is a delightful rural village and civil parish situated in County Durham, in England. Boasting a range of old, traditional country cottages, shadowed by a delightful village green and is within reach of some lovely pubs and eateries.
